
React Complete Course for Beginners
Course Description
OVERVIEW:
After completing the React.js Complete Course in Urdu and Hindi, you will be master of React.js and will be able to create web applications in React.js In this course we will cover all the fundamentals of React.js. This Course is Designed for absolute beginners you don't need any previous React.js knowledge to take this course.
This course will help you understand basic and advance concepts in React.js. you will have a complete understanding of react.js concepts. You will learn about Different Types of components is react.js. You will learn about life cycle methods and you will also learn about Hooks in React.js.
INTRODUCTION:
React.js is a JavaScript framework for building user interfaces. It is good at one thing and that is creating beautiful user interfaces. React.js is in top Three JavaScript frameworks for Frontend Development. It is created and maintained by Facebook. This means that this is worth learning React.js. After learning React.js you can also learn Others framework like Next.js which is React.js framework.
PREREQUISITES:
Before starting this course, you should have a working knowledge of Following:
- Basic Knowledge of HTML, CSS
- JavaScript Fundamentals
- JavaScript ES6 features
This training is compatible with Windows 8, Windows 8.1, Windows 10, Windows 11, & MAC operating system.
CERTIFICATION:
You are hereby advised to visit www.virtualacademy.pk and get yourself certified in React.js Training, furthermore you'll have to meet the following criteria for earning this particular Registered Certification.
- You will have to complete all 34 lessons through Virtual Academy Online Learning Management System at www.virtualacademy.pk.
- Every lesson has 3 to 5 quizzes, which you must have to pass with 70% marks.
- You need to submit your project/assignments on time.
- After completion of Virtual Academy offered React.js Basic to Advanced Training lessons via www.virtualacademy.pk Online Learning Management System there will be final exam which comprises of 50 to 100 questions.
After having assessment of your account with www.virtualacademy.pk whether you meet all the above terms and conditions, then we will dispatch your Certificate/Diploma at your given address.
COURSE CONTENTS
Introduction
- What is React.js
- How to create new react app
- Folder Structure
- How to run React app
Components
- What is Component
- Different types of Components
- Class and Functional Components
State and Props
- What is State
- What is Props
- How to define Sate in Class Component
- useState Hook
- Destructuring State and Props
- Method as props
Others Concepts
- List Rendering
- Form handling
- Styling React app
- Event handling
- Fetching data from an API
- Refs
- Fragments
- Pure Components
- Higher Order Components
Lifecycle methods
Hooks
- useEffect
- useRef
- useMemo
- useContext
- useCallback
Final Exam and Certification
Course Curriculum
- 1. React Course Introduction
- 2. What is React.js & Prerequisites
- 3. Creating First React App
- 4. Folder Structure of React App
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Introduction to Components
- 2. Functional Components
- 3. Class Components
- 4. What is JSX
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Props in React
- 2. State in React
- 3. setState in React
- 4. Destructuring props and state
- 5. useState Hook
- 6. useState with Previous State
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Event Handling in React
- 2. Passing Methods as Props
- 3. Conditional Rendering
- 4. List Rendering
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Styling React App
- 2. Adding Bootstrap
- 3. Adding Icons
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Forms in Class Components
- 2. Forms in Functional Components
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Lifecycle Methods Overview
- 2. Component Mounting
- 3. Component Updating
- 4. useEffect Hook
- 5. Fetching Data with useEffect
No Quiz For This Chapter.
No Notes available for this chapter
- 1. React Fragments
- 2. Pure Components
- 3. useMemo Hook
No Quiz For This Chapter.
No Notes available for this chapter
- 1. Refs in Class Components
- 2. useRef Hook
- 3. Higher Order Components (HOC)
No Quiz For This Chapter.
No Notes available for this chapter
No Chapter Items
No Quiz For This Chapter.
No Notes available for this chapter